Summary: "The Fan, the Referee and the Footballer" is a 1983 sports drama film that explores the complex relationships between a passionate football fan, a dedicated referee, and a talented footballer. Set against the backdrop of a high-stakes football match, the movie delves into the personal struggles and ethical dilemmas faced by each character as they navigate the intense emotions and pressures of the sport. Through their interconnected stories, the film examines themes of loyalty, ambition, and the impact of sports on individuals and communities.
